Overview: The Rockaway Township School Board meeting revolved around policy amendments, particularly the introduction of a new cell phone policy in response to New Jersey’s bell-to-bell school cell phone law. The board emphasized the necessity of adopting this policy by the start of the school year to comply with state mandates. Additionally, the board engaged in discussions on improving communication with the community, addressing parental concerns, and fostering a positive educational environment through social-emotional learning.

Overview: During the recent Winslow School Board meeting, key leadership changes and a new cell phone policy were at the forefront of discussions. Dr. Cibble Gerard was introduced as the new high school principal, replacing Mr. Mela, who is transitioning to School 6. Dr. Stacy Diggs sought board approval to become the principal at School 4. The superintendent expressed enthusiasm about the fresh energy these leaders bring and the potential for academic progress in the upcoming school year. Meanwhile, a new policy prohibiting cell phones in school buildings was announced. The policy includes using pouches to store devices and seeks parental support to ensure its success.

Poudre School Board Appoints New Member Amid Discussions on School Closures and Community Engagement
Overview: In a recent meeting, the Poudre School Board appointed Ozlem Gurkan as a new board member, following a detailed evaluation of several candidates. This appointment came amidst broader discussions on pressing district issues, including potential school closures due to declining enrollment and budget constraints. The board also tackled topics related to graduation requirements, community engagement, and the implications of integrating technology in education.

Overview: The Fort Worth Independent School Board meeting focused on issues such as the significant departure of educators from the district, policy revisions regarding educator contracts, and ongoing community concerns about school operations and student support services. The meeting illuminated the challenges the district faces in retaining qualified staff and maintaining effective communication with community members.

Overview: During the recent Bernards Township Council meeting, the introduction of Ordinance 2603, aimed at improving property maintenance standards for non-residential properties, emerged as the focal point. This ordinance seeks to enhance the aesthetic appeal of neighborhoods, ensure resident safety, and protect property values by establishing minimum maintenance standards. A public hearing on this matter is scheduled for August 25, 2026, allowing residents to voice their opinions.
